Setting Up SpringBoot JUnit Integration
Initial Setup
To start with SpringBoot JUnit integration, ensure you have the right dependencies in your pom.xml
or build.gradle
file. Here's an example snippet for Maven:
<dependency>
<groupId>org.springframework.boot</groupId>
<artifactId>spring-boot-starter-test</artifactId>
<scope>test</scope>
</dependency>
Structuring Your Tests
A well-structured test is like a well-organized closet—everything has its place. Structure your tests by organizing them into unit and integration tests clearly.Â
Utilize the @SpringBootTest
annotation for integration tests to load the application context.
Writing a Basic Test
Create a basic JUnit test case with @Test
annotation. Here's a simple example demonstrating a test for a SpringBoot application:
@RunWith(SpringRunner.class)
@SpringBootTest
public class ApplicationTests {
@Test
public void contextLoads() {
}
}
This test checks if the application context loads correctly—a foundational step for your robust testing framework.

Common Challenges and Solutions
Handling Application Context
The application context is at the heart of Spring integration. Problems often arise when the context doesn't load as expected.Â
Ensure your configurations are accurate and that the context is correctly wired before executing the tests.
Dealing with Test Data
Using realistic test data is crucial. Mock your data carefully, or consider using in-memory databases like H2 to simulate a real database environment without the hassle.
